With millennia of history and limited space, large cities pose ambitious challenges when it comes to developing new solutions for urban parking, and combining the latest technology with existing facilities.
One example is the installation developed by HUB Italia in Rome for the MA supermarket in the Ostiense district. Located in a residential complex, the supermarket offers customers an underground parking lot whose access is controlled by HUB peripherals completely customized to adapt to the available spaces.
The access ramp to the parking lot, in fact, would not allow the installation of standard size peripherals. For this reason, the HUB Italia team has created a unique solution that would completely adapt to the needs of the site, and secured the barrier in a housing adjacent to the ramp itself.
For MA's customers, no interruptions in and out of the parking lot: the route is fluid, and you can pay the parking directly at the cash desk at the end of the shopping. In fact, the integration of JMS with the supermarket checkout management system allows you to get a discount at the rate directly on the receipt, and pay together with your purchases.
